2.8.1 — Crashmill pipeline key rotation. Old symbol-upload signatures stop validating at the end of the month. Plugin authors must re-sign pending uploads; queued reports signed with the retired key will be dropped, not retried. No API changes otherwise. All new uploads should be signed with the key below.

deploy key for kafof-kaguf: bky9_WnPyu8S2E

**Action Item PM-88: Kiosk watchdog hardening**

The Perchlight kiosk watchdog failed to restart the app after a GPU hang because it only checked process liveness, not screen output. This change adds a frame-heartbeat check. Reviewer: verify the heartbeat interval matches the spec and that false restarts are rate-limited. Full watchdog design notes are on the internal page.

runbook for badug-kadup: https://confluence.zemvarlabs.internal/projects/browse/display/projects/bd1b

## Runbook: Dispatchloom driver-assignment heuristic

Heuristic scores drivers by proximity, shift remaining, and vehicle class. Scores refresh every 20s. If assignments stall, check the scoring worker first, then the Routemarrow feed. Do not restart both simultaneously. Manual overrides go through the ops endpoint only. To call the ops endpoint from the bastion, authenticate with the key below.

app token of yajeg-kawef = kto11_7En3XSX8xQw

## Changelog — Ticktrace 1.9

### Renamed: DRIFT_API_TOKEN
During the cron drift investigation we found plugins confusing this variable with the metrics token, so it has been renamed to indicate it authorizes drift-report uploads specifically. Plugin authors must read the new name from 1.9 onward; the old name is ignored without warning. Sample env files in the SDK are updated. In your deployment env file, the drift-report upload secret is set on the next line.

env line for fawef-taguf: VAULT_KEY13=a9695905a9a90